Transaction 740d5fd712427507a1b38bb2c9699eee1324e02f2c420b6fe26286cc8eaef146

3 Input
2 Outputs
  • 740d5fd712427507a1b38bb2c9699eee1324e02f2c420b6fe26286cc8eaef146:0
  • value  425681
    address  13nZDpPjoCZ1k3JVnFHTReKPJWqkeLLDjQ
  • 740d5fd712427507a1b38bb2c9699eee1324e02f2c420b6fe26286cc8eaef146:1
  • value  2729286
    address  38FrpwNAce53mL6aaAmenrtRMNCi99d95P